:root,
[data-bs-theme=light]{
  --ui-nav-link-color:#000;
  --ui-nav-link-hover-bg:#f2f3f7; /* background:rgba(0, 0, 0, .05); */
  --ui-nav-link-border-radius:8px;
  --ui-nav-link-padding-x:12px;
  --ui-nav-link-padding-y:12px;

  /**
   * Form
   */
  --form-border-width:1.5px;
  --form-border-style:solid;
  --form-border-color:#e2e5eb;
  --form-border-radius:4px;
  --form-input-box-shadow:0px 0px 1px 0px #e2e5eb;
  --form-input-focus-border-color:#bbc1c7;
  --form-input-focus-box-shadow:0 0 3px 0 rgba(0, 0, 0, .05);
  --form-valid-color:#28a745;
  --form-invalid-color:#e51818;
  --form-invalid-box-shadow:0 0 3px 0 rgba(220, 53, 69, .25);
  --form-invalid-focus-box-shadow:0px 0px 1px 0px #e51818;
  /* --form-invalid-box-shadow:0px 0px 1px 0px #dc3545;; */
  /* --form-invalid-color:#dc3545; */
  /**
   * Height
   */
  --height-xxl:5.2rem; /* 52px */
  --height-xl:4.8rem; /* 48px */
  --height-l:4.4rem; /* 44px */
  --height-m:4.0rem; /* 40px !!! */
  --height-s:3.6rem; /* 36px */
  --height-xs:3.2rem; /* 32px */
  --height-xxs:2.8rem; /* 28px */
  /**
   * Background
   */
  --bg-primary:#cce5ff;
  --bg-success:#d4edda;
  --bg-warning:#fff3cd;
  --bg-danger:#fce4eb;
  --bg-light:#ddd;
  --bg-dark:#000;
  /**
   * Background color
   */
  --bg-color-primary:#004085;
  --bg-color-success:#155724;
  --bg-color-warning:#856404;
  --bg-color-danger:#ed4c78;
  --bg-color-light:#212529;
  --bg-color-dark:#fff;
  /**
   * json highlighter
   */
  --app-language-json-key-color:#871094;
  --app-language-json-string-color:#067d17;
  --app-language-json-number-color:#1750eb;
  --app-language-json-boolean-color:#0033b3;
  --app-language-json-null-color:#0033b3;
  --app-language-json-comment-color:#8c8c8c;

  /**
   * font-size
   */
  /*   --ui-font-size-10:1rem;
    --ui-font-size-12:1.2rem;
    --ui-font-size-14:1.4rem;
    --ui-font-size-16:1.6rem;
    --ui-font-size-18:1.8rem;
    --ui-font-size-20:2rem;
    --ui-font-size-22:2.2rem;
    --ui-font-size-24:2.4rem; */

  /**
   * font-size
   */
  --ui-font-size-h1:21px;
  --ui-font-size-h2:19px;
  --ui-font-size-h3:17px;
  --ui-font-size-h4:15px;
  --ui-font-size-h5:13px;
  --ui-font-size-h6:11px;

  /*
   * @media
   */
  /* :root{
    --bs-breakpoint-xs:0;
    --bs-breakpoint-sm:576px;
    --bs-breakpoint-md:768px;
    --bs-breakpoint-lg:992px;
    --bs-breakpoint-xl:1200px;
    --bs-breakpoint-xxl:1400px;
  } */

  @media (min-width:576px){
  }
  @media (min-width:768px){
    --ui-font-size-h1:22px;
    --ui-font-size-h2:20px;
    --ui-font-size-h3:18px;
    --ui-font-size-h4:16px;
    --ui-font-size-h5:14px;
    --ui-font-size-h6:12px;
  }
  @media (min-width:992px){

  }
  @media (min-width:1200px){
    --ui-font-size-h1:24px;
    --ui-font-size-h2:22px;
    --ui-font-size-h3:20px;
    --ui-font-size-h4:18px;
    --ui-font-size-h5:16px;
    --ui-font-size-h6:14px;
  }
  @media (min-width:1400px){
  }

}

[data-bs-theme=dark]{
  --ui-nav-link-hover-bg:#f2f3f7; /* background:rgba(255, 255, 255, .1); */

  /**
   * json highlighter
   */
  --app-language-json-key-color:#9876aa;
  --app-language-json-string-color:#ff9c91;
  --app-language-json-number-color:#6897bb;
  --app-language-json-boolean-color:#cc7832;
  --app-language-json-null-color:#cc7832;
  --app-language-json-comment-color:#808080;
}

/*
 * @media
 */
@media (min-width:576px){
}
@media (min-width:768px){
}
@media (min-width:992px){
}
@media (min-width:1200px){
}
@media (min-width:1400px){
}